Alexander A. Deutsch , pseudonym aleXdrum (born August 9, 1959 in Irdning ) is an Austrian musician .

Live and act

Alex German (2010)

German grew up in Styria. In 1977 he graduated from the University of Music and Performing Arts in Graz . In the 1980s, Deutsch lived in America, where he worked with Hal Crook and Jerry Bergonzi , but also recorded his first albums under his own name. He also worked with Wolfgang Muthspiel , Tone Janša , Torsten de Winkel and Jamaaladeen Tacuma . In 1998 he replaced Anders Stenmo , who suffered from a sudden hearing loss , and became the drummer of the First General Insecurity . During the Himmel & Hölle tour 98 he fell ill with pneumonia and had to leave the band after a few months. He was replaced by Robert Baumgartner .

2005 learned German, at that time drummer of the Vienna Jazz Groove Formation Café Drechsler , Anna F. know. He later became her closest adviser, partner and drummer for her band. In 2006, Deutsch was awarded the Hans Koller Prize as Musician of the Year .

In the run-up to the 2015 Eurovision Song Contest in Austria, at the end of 2014 he and Anna F. were part of the ORF team that was looking for candidates for the Austrian contribution.
